Chapter 1: School bus licence
In Ontario, driving a school bus requires a special licence, either a Class B or a Class E. Applicants must already hold a valid G-class driver’s licence and meet specific medical and vision standards.

They must also complete a Ministry-approved school bus driver training program and pass both written and road tests. Additionally, a clear criminal record check and a vulnerable sector screening are mandatory. School bus drivers play a crucial role in student safety, so Ontario maintains strict requirements to ensure only qualified individuals transport children. Regular renewals and ongoing training are also required for licence holders.
